The E2E-X1C1-M5 is a proximity sensor belonging to the category of industrial automation sensors. It is commonly used for detecting the presence or absence of an object without physical contact, making it suitable for various applications in manufacturing and assembly processes. The sensor is known for its compact design, high precision, and reliable performance. It is typically packaged in a durable housing with a protective cover and is available in single-unit packaging.
The E2E-X1C1-M5 features a 3-pin configuration: 1. Brown wire - V+ 2. Blue wire - 0V 3. Black wire - Signal output
The E2E-X1C1-M5 operates based on the principle of electromagnetic induction. When an object enters the sensor's detection range, it causes changes in the sensor's electromagnetic field, leading to the activation of the output signal. This non-contact sensing principle ensures minimal wear and tear, contributing to the sensor's longevity.
The E2E-X1C1-M5 is commonly used in the following applications: - Automated assembly lines for part presence verification - Conveyor systems for detecting product positioning - Packaging machinery for ensuring proper material handling
